Delve into advanced concepts of pointwise convergence in ergodic theory and analysis with Mariusz Mirek from Rutgers University, USA, in this hour-long lecture. Explore complex mathematical principles and their applications as the second part of a comprehensive series on the subject. Gain insights into cutting-edge research and theoretical developments in this specialized field of mathematics.
